Abstract

The invention discloses a drum washing machine, a water spraying device and a drum assembly for the drum washing machine, wherein the water spraying device comprises: the box body is internally limited with a water containing cavity, and is provided with an outer mounting surface used for being connected with a roller of the roller washing machine and an inner water spraying surface opposite to the outer mounting surface, and the inner water spraying surface is provided with at least one water spraying hole communicated with the water containing cavity; at least one division plate is arranged in the water containing cavity to divide the water containing cavity into a plurality of water distributing cavities, and each water distributing cavity is connected with at least one water spraying hole. According to the water spraying device provided by the embodiment of the invention, the washing effect and efficiency can be improved, and the cost is reduced.

Background
The drum washing machine washes clothes by the principle that the clothes are lifted, dropped and beaten under the action of the rotation of the inner drum driven by the motor and the lifting ribs. Compared with the pulsator washing machine, the drum washing machine can save water resources, but has the defect that clothes cannot be fully infiltrated and mixed with washing water like the pulsator washing machine. In view of this, a shower type apparatus has been developed in which washing water is sprayed on laundry by a water pump so that the washing water and the laundry are sufficiently soaked and washed, a washing ratio is improved, and a washing time is saved, but an additional washing shower increases power consumption and cost.

The drum assembly 100 and the water spray device 20 according to the embodiment of the present invention are described in detail with reference to the accompanying drawings.
Referring to fig. 1 to 5, a drum assembly 100 according to an embodiment of the present invention may include: a drum 10 and a shower 20. The drum 10 defines a tub 101 therein, and laundry may be placed in the tub 101 for washing. As shown in fig. 1, lifting ribs 30 may be selectively provided on the inner sidewall of the drum 10, and the lifting ribs 30 may extend in the axial direction of the drum 10 to lift laundry, thereby improving washing effect.
The water spraying device 20 is connected with the drum 10 and is arranged in the drum cavity 101, the water spraying device 20 can rotate along with the drum 10 and spray water to clothes, so that the clothes can be fully soaked by the washing water, the washing ratio is improved, and the washing time is saved. The water drenching device 20 may include at least one. That is, one shower 20 may be provided in the drum 10, or two or more shower 20 may be provided, and particularly, may be flexibly provided according to the size of the drum 10, washing requirements, and the like.
More preferably, the water spraying device 20 may be detachably connected to the drum assembly 100. That is, the water spraying device 20 can be detached from the drum 10 when not in use, and can be used as an optional accessory of the drum assembly 100, so that the use is more flexible, and the autonomous selectivity of a user is increased.
The shower 20 will be described in detail. Referring to fig. 1 to 5, the water spraying apparatus 20 may include a case 21 and a plurality of partition plates 22. The box body 21 may define a water containing cavity 201 therein, the box body 21 has an outer mounting surface 210 and an inner water spraying surface 220, the outer mounting surface 210 may be connected to the drum 10, and the outer mounting surface 210 and the inner water spraying surface 220 are disposed opposite to each other. The inner water spraying surface 220 is provided with a plurality of water spraying holes 202 communicated with the water containing cavity 201. The partition plate 22 is disposed in the water containing cavity 201 to divide the water containing cavity 201 into a plurality of water separating cavities 2011, and each water separating cavity 2011 is connected to at least one water spraying hole 202.
Therefore, when the water spraying device 20 pivots along with the drum 10, the water spraying device 20 can be completely or partially immersed in the washing water in the drum cavity 101 when moving to the low position, the washing water is sucked into the water containing cavity 201 through the water spraying holes 202 on the outer mounting surface 210 of the box body 21 and is stored in the water distributing cavities 2011 under the action of the inner partition plate 22, and when the water spraying device 20 rotates to the high position along with the drum 10, the washing water can flow out from the water spraying holes 202 and spray on the surface of the clothes under the self gravity, so that the clothes and the washing liquid are fully immersed, the washing ratio is improved, and the washing time is saved. The partition plate 22 can separate the washing water in the water containing cavity 201, so that the concentrated distribution of the washing water is avoided, the water inlet and outlet are smoother, the water spraying is more uniform, and the water spraying effect can be improved.
The drum assembly 100 having the water spraying device 20 can achieve the effect of spraying the washing water on the clothes by utilizing the rotation of the drum assembly, so that the washing water and the clothes are more fully soaked and washed, the washing ratio is improved, the washing time is saved, the washing effect and the washing efficiency are improved, the number of parts can be reduced, the power consumption is reduced, the cost and the structural complexity are effectively reduced, and the manufacturability is strong.
In addition, when the drum assembly 100 is in operation, the filth falling from the clothes can enter the water spraying device 20 together with the washing water, so that the water spraying device 20 can also play a role in collecting the washing filth, the washing performance is further improved, and a user can clean the water spraying device 20, for example, the water spraying device 20 can be detached from the drum 10 for washing.

According to some embodiments of the present invention, the case 21 may be provided on an inner sidewall of the drum 10, and the water-receiving chamber 201 may extend in a circumferential direction of the drum 10. Here, the "the water containing chamber 201 extends along the circumferential direction of the drum 10" may be understood in a broad sense, that is, it may be understood that the water containing chamber 201 extends in an arc-shaped manner along the circumferential direction of the drum 10, and it may be understood that the water containing chamber 201 extends in a straight line or a zigzag manner along the circumferential direction of the drum 10. Therefore, in the process that the water spraying device 20 rotates along with the roller 10, the time of the box body 21 in the washing water of the cylinder cavity 101 is longer, the water inlet time of the water containing cavity 201 is longer, the water inlet quantity of the water containing cavity 201 is higher, the water spraying quantity is higher, and the water spraying effect can be further improved.
Further, the partition plate 22 may include a plurality of partition plates 22 may be disposed at intervals along the extending direction of the water containing chamber 201. That is, when the water spraying device 20 is mounted on the drum 10, the plurality of partition plates 22 may be arranged at intervals along the circumferential direction of the drum 10, so that the plurality of water distribution cavities 2011 may be distributed in the box 21 along the circumferential direction of the drum 10, the plurality of water distribution cavities 2011 may sequentially receive water and output water during the pivoting of the water spraying device 20 along with the drum 10, the water receiving and outputting effect of the water spraying device 20 is better, the water receiving and outputting time is relatively longer, and the water spraying effect is further improved.
Referring to fig. 2 to 5, the case 21 and the water chamber 201 extend in an arc shape in the circumferential direction of the drum 10, respectively. Thus, both the outer mounting surface 210 and the inner water spraying surface 220 of the case 21 may be formed as arc surfaces, which have better fit with the inner sidewall of the drum 10, are more firmly mounted, and have better water spraying effect. As shown in fig. 4, the entire outer surface of the case 21 may be smoothly disposed, and corners of the case 21 may be smoothly transited. Thus, the abrasion of the shower 20 to the laundry can be reduced, and the washing damage of the laundry can be reduced. As shown in fig. 4, the outer mounting surface 210 and the inner water spraying surface 220 may be formed as substantially parallel arcuate surfaces. Therefore, the appearance effect can be improved, the abrasion to clothes is smaller, and the water spraying effect is better.
As shown in fig. 4, the outer ends of the plurality of partition plates 22 may be connected to the outer mounting surface 210, and the inner ends of the plurality of partition plates 22 may be spaced apart from the inner water shower surface 220. Here, the outer end of the partition plate 22 is an end of the partition plate 22 away from the central axis of the drum 10, and the inner end of the partition plate 22 is an end of the partition plate 22 adjacent to the central axis of the drum 10. From this, the outer end accessible division board 22 of a plurality of water distribution cavities 2011 cuts off, and the inner intercommunication setting of a plurality of water distribution cavities 2011, and the water distribution effect is better to it is more thorough to go out the water, and the play water effect improves, can further improve the water drenching effect.
Further, the plurality of partition plates 22 may include a first partition plate 221 and a second partition plate 222, as shown in fig. 4, in the extending direction of the water containing chamber, the first partition plate 221 and the second partition plate 222 are respectively provided in both half chambers of the water containing chamber 201. Here, the two half cavities are two half cavities of the water containing cavity 201 distributed along the circumferential direction of the drum, and the two half cavities form the water containing cavity 201. The first barrier 221 and the second barrier 222 extend from outside to inside in a direction away from each other. Here, the direction extending from the outside to the inside is substantially along the radial direction of the drum 10 from the position away from the drum 10 toward the central axis of the drum 10. That is, from the outside to the inside, the first barrier 221 and the second barrier 222 extend away from each other, and the distance between the first barrier 221 and the second barrier 222 increases.
Thus, the first partition 221 and the second partition 222 may be approximately shaped like a Chinese character 'ba', and the two water diversion cavities 2011 partitioned by the first partition 221 and the second partition 222 extend obliquely relative to the radial direction of the drum 10 and have opposite extending directions, wherein one water diversion cavity 2011 can discharge water in the process that the water spraying device 20 rotates from a low position to a high position, the other water diversion cavity 2011 can discharge water in the process that the water spraying device 20 rotates from a high position to a low position, the water spraying device 20 sprays water more uniformly in the rotating process, and the water spraying effect is further improved.
In the embodiment shown in fig. 4, the number of the first partitions 221 and the second partitions 222 is four, respectively, and it is understood that the number of the first partitions 221 and the second partitions 222 is not limited thereto, and in the present invention, the number of the first partitions 221 may be one, two, three, five or more than five, and the number of the second partitions 222 may be one, two, three, five or more than five, that is, in the present invention, the number of the first partitions 221 and the second partitions 222 may be at least one, respectively, and the specific number may be flexibly set according to practical situations.
As shown in fig. 4, the first barrier 221 and the second barrier 222 may be formed as arc plates, respectively. Therefore, the flow guiding and separating effects can be improved, the water flow is smoother, and the water flow noise is smaller. The bending radian of the arc-shaped plate can be flexibly set according to actual conditions, and the invention is not particularly limited to the method.
Further, the plurality of first partitions 221 may be disposed in parallel, and the plurality of second partitions 222 may be disposed in parallel. Therefore, a plurality of arc-shaped plates which are arranged in parallel can be arranged in one half cavity of the water containing cavity 201, and a plurality of arc-shaped plates which are arranged in parallel can also be arranged in the other half cavity of the water containing cavity 201, so that the separation and flow guiding effects are good. The first partition plates 221 and the second partition plates 222 may be disposed at equal intervals, so that the distribution and the size of the water distribution cavity 2011 are more uniform, and the water inlet and outlet effects are better.
As shown in fig. 4, the distance between the adjacent first and second separators 221 and 222 may be greater than the distance between the adjacent two first separators 221, and the distance between the adjacent first and second separators 221 and 222 is also greater than the distance between the adjacent two second separators 222. The size of the water spraying holes 202 corresponding to the positions of the water diversion cavities 2011 between the adjacent first partition plate 221 and second partition plate 222 may be larger than the size of the water spraying holes 202 corresponding to the water diversion cavities 2011 partitioned by the first partition plate 221 and also larger than the size of the water spraying holes 202 corresponding to the water diversion cavities 2011 partitioned by the second partition plate 222. Therefore, the water outlet in the middle of the water spraying device 20 is larger, the water outlet at the two sides is smaller, the water power is stronger, and the water spraying effect is better.
In the present invention, the number and distribution of the shower holes 202 are not particularly limited. According to some embodiments of the present invention, the water spray holes 202 may be distributed in a matrix or the like, for example, the water spray holes 202 may be distributed in a plurality of rows along the circumferential direction of the drum 10, each row includes a plurality of water spray holes 202 disposed at intervals along the axial direction of the drum 10, and the plurality of water spray holes 202 in the same row may be the same size or different sizes, and the water spray holes 202 in different rows may be the same size or different sizes.
Referring to fig. 1 to 4, the water spray holes 202 may include seven rows, the water spray holes 202 in the middle row having the largest size, and the water spray holes 202 on both sides having smaller sizes, wherein the water spray holes 202 in the left and right rows located on both sides of the middle row and adjacent to the middle row have smaller sizes than the water spray holes 202 of the middle row and larger sizes than the water spray holes 202 of the one row located at the edge. Therefore, the water spraying device 20 has more water outlet in the middle, stronger waterpower and finer water outlet at the two sides, so that clothes can be well soaked, and the water spraying effect is good.
In some preferred embodiments of the present invention, the outer mounting surface 210 may be provided with a water outlet 203 in communication with the water containing cavity 201, and the water outlet 203 corresponds to the position of the water through hole 102 on the drum 10. Therefore, when the roller 10 is driven by the motor to spin, the water spraying device 20 can rotate at a high speed along with the roller 10, and water in the water containing cavity 201 can be sequentially discharged through the water outlet 203 and the water through hole 102 under the action of centrifugal force, so that the water draining performance is good.
As shown in fig. 5, the water outlet holes 203 may be distributed in two rows along the axial direction of the drum, and the two water outlet holes are respectively disposed adjacent to two ends of the case 21, that is, the two water outlet holes are respectively adjacent to two ends of the outer mounting surface 210 along the axial direction of the drum 10, and each water outlet hole 203 includes a plurality of water outlet holes 203 spaced apart along the circumferential direction of the drum 10. This facilitates water discharge, and further improves the water discharge effect.
As an alternative embodiment, the outer mounting surface 210 may be provided with a clamping portion, and the clamping portion may be connected to the drum 10 in a clamping manner, so that the water spraying device 20 may be clamped to the drum 10, so that the connection is firm and the operation is convenient. The specific structure of the clamping portion is not particularly limited, and for example, the clamping portion may be a structure capable of realizing clamping, such as a hook, a clamping column, or a clamping groove.
In some embodiments of the present invention, the cassette 21 is integrally formed with the divider plate 22. That is, the water shower 20 may be an integral piece. Therefore, the water spraying device 20 has strong strength and sealing performance, is convenient to form and simple to manufacture, omits redundant assembly parts and connection procedures, and is easier for industrial production.
The material of the case 21 and the partition plate 22 may be the same or different. The case 21 and the partition plate 22 may be made of metal or plastic. In some embodiments of the present invention, the drum 10, the box 21 and the partition plate 22 are all made of stainless steel, so that the strength is high, rust is avoided, and the washing effect is good.
Of course, the case 21 and the partition plate 22 may be formed separately. Therefore, when manufacturing the shower device 20, the partition plate 22 formed by manufacturing is only required to be installed in the box body 21, so that the shower device is convenient to manufacture and convenient to replace.
